"Many people think voice over artists just read, there's much more to it. Without acting beats, scene study and improving skills, you won't make it"
About this Quote
Her phrasing matters. “Just read” is deliberately small, almost dismissive, because that’s how the misconception functions: it shrinks the work until it looks like clerical duty. Then she counters with the insider’s vocabulary - “acting beats,” “scene study” - terms that signal not gatekeeping so much as fluency. The subtext is blunt: if you don’t understand story and intention, your performance will be technically clear and emotionally dead. In animation and games, where the face isn’t doing the lifting, the voice has to carry impulse, subtext, timing, and shifts in power. That’s acting, not diction.
Contextually, Strong’s authority is hard-earned: she’s voiced iconic characters across decades, in an era where social media and cheap home studios have made entry feel deceptively easy. Her warning is less “don’t try” than “don’t disrespect the workload.” In an attention economy that loves the idea of effortless talent, she’s insisting on process - and on the fact that audiences can hear the difference.
